Exhibit A Melvina Hatch RE Benjamin Hatch.
Exhibit A Melvina Hatch RE Benjamin Hatch.
On 20 February 1878 Melvins testified about Benjamin Hatch. In the summer of 1865 she went with Hatch to Lawrence, Massachusetts. She was supported by Hatch and he said he would marry her but, after moving in with him she learned he was already married and his wife was still living. She lived with him until the fall of 1874 using his last name. After he left she was supported by her children.

F Troop.
F Troop.
Melody is best known as Wrangler Jane from the 60's TV Sitcom "F Troop". She got the roll when she was only 16 years old by using a forged birth certificate. Once the executives found out production had begun and, she had proven herself mature enough to handle the job.

Sadly F troop only lasted two seasons. It did well in the ratings but, it was tying up studio locations that the studio wanted to free up for filming western themed movies.

F-104 McKay.
F-104 McKay.
John piloting the F-104. NASA used the fighter as a chase plane for the X-15 test program. They also had three of them specially modified with directional thrusters in the nose and wing tips to train pilots for flight outside of the earth's atmosphere.

Fabyan Villa.
Fabyan Villa.
The home of Colonel George Fayban was redesigned and enlarged by Frank Lloyd Wright in 1907. It is on the Register of Historic Places and is now part of Fayban Forest Preserve in Batavia, Illinois.
